Taekwondo is the largest martial art in the world with over 75,000,000 active participants in over 200 different countries. In Australia it was originally know as Korean Karate, but around the early 70′s we learned to call it Taekwondo. It is now an Olympic Sport and has the highest degree of government recognition of any martial art.
There are many elements that are similar with other martial arts such as karate, kung fu, judo, ju jitsu and boxing. But Taekwondo is famous for it’s spectacular kicking techniques and it’s place in Olympic Sport.
